WebMay 10, 2024 · If these sections are not airtight, they let water and moisture seep through the roof, condense on the ceiling and stain it. 3. Ice Dam Leakage. If stains appear at ceiling corners or outside walls, the most probable cause is ice dam leakage. This happens when insulation in the attic is insufficient. Wallpaper … law for justiceWebOct 31, 2024 · A roof’s slope is the number of inches it rises for every 12 inches of horizontal “run.”. A roof with a “4-in-12 slope” rises 4 inches for every 12 inches of horizontal run. The same roof has a 4/12—or 1/3—pitch.
